摘要:本文详细介绍了大型网站建设方案,引出读者的兴趣,并提供了背景信息。
大型网站建设方案是一个复杂而庞大的项目,需要从多个方面综合考虑。本文将从以下四个方面进行详细阐述:技术架构设计、用户界面设计、数据库设计和安全策略。
一、技术架构设计
1. 选择合适的服务器架构:根据网站规模和预期流量,选取适当的服务器数量和类型,配置负载均衡和反向代理等技术,以提高网站的访问速度和稳定性。
2. 前后端分离开发:通过前后端分离架构,将前端界面与后端逻辑分离,提高开发效率和系统的可维护性。
3. 使用云服务:借助云服务提供商的弹性扩展能力和高可用性,减少服务器和系统维护成本,并提升用户体验。
二、用户界面设计
1. 用户友好的界面设计:考虑用户需求和使用习惯,设计简洁、直观的用户界面,提供良好的用户体验。
2. 响应式设计:针对不同的设备和屏幕尺寸,进行响应式设计,保证网站在各种终端上的显示效果良好。
3. 多语言支持:根据用户群体的需求,提供多种语言的界面选择,以增加用户粘性和全球化的能力。
三、数据库设计
1. 数据库规划:根据网站的需求和数据量预估,选择合适的数据库类型和架构,设计优化的数据库结构和索引,提升数据库的性能和可扩展性。
2. 数据备份和灾备:建立完善的数据库备份和灾备机制,保证数据的安全性和可恢复性,减少因数据库故障引起的服务中断和数据丢失的风险。
3. 数据库安全性:加强数据库的安全防护,采用合适的加密算法、访问控制策略和审计机制,防止数据库遭到攻击和非法访问。
四、安全策略
1. 防火墙和入侵检测系统:配置防火墙和入侵检测系统,防止恶意攻击和未经授权的访问。
2. 用户认证和权限控制:采用安全的用户认证机制和权限管理系统,确保用户的身份和权限的合法性,防止数据泄露和非法操作。
3. 数据加密和传输安全:使用合适的加密算法对敏感数据进行加密存储和传输,保护用户隐私和系统的安全性。
结论:大型网站建设方案需要综合考虑技术架构、用户界面、数据库和安全策略等多个方面。通过合理的设计和规划,可以提高网站的性能、可用性和安全性,提升用户的体验和满意度。这些建设方案的具体实施需要根据具体情况进行调整和优化,以适应不断变化的互联网环境和用户需求。未来的研究方向可以从人工智能、大数据分析和云计算等方面探索如何进一步提升大型网站的建设和运营效果。
地址:无锡市滨湖区慧泽路210号往西南约110米
地址:南京市雨花台区安德门大街52号雨花世茂5楼
地址:杭州市拱墅区杭行路666号万达广场B座17层
地址:上海市长宁区长宁路1018号龙之梦国际大厦8层
地址:合肥市蜀山区莲花路646西50米尚泽大都会A座23层